No it's fairly standard human psychology actually. Atheists miss a lot of truth but science is right when it says humans are naturally pattern forming creatures. It's a good thing and helps us to understand the world. It helps you remember your mom is actually your mom every time she pops out of the room for example.

Another thing is when you look in front of you not everything you think you see is actually being seen. Allot of it is merely your brain filling in the blanks. We process vast amounts of information everyday it's breathtakingly fascinating how much and your brain needs some way to contextualise, limit and sort this information.

Sometimes this sorting mechanism gets a little over active. Understanding this mechanism may help you deal with your problem.

This is most likely stemming from some form of mental illness. I'm not saying that to frighten you or insult you; I've dealt with anxiety and depression all my life. And while there is a spiritual slant to everything we go through, I very much doubt that this is some type of "possession". I would encourage you to be evaluated by a professional counselor or therapist. There is nothing unChristian about admitting that sometimes we get a little "out of sync" upstairs, and sometimes you need more than prayers to get help. When I was in the worst depths of my depression, I was having panic attacks, obsessive thoughts, I felt like I was in a dream all the time, and the world wasn't real; it's terrifying. But I wasn't possessed and I didn't overcome it by praying. I had to acknowlege that there were physical and mental aspects in play, and I had to deal with them head-on, and it took a lot of work and patience to recover and get better. But you CAN get better.
